Drain Pipe Repair in Denver, CO
Drain pipe repair services address issues related to damaged, cracked, or clogged drain pipes that can affect a property's plumbing system. These services typically cover a range of projects, including fixing leaks, replacing broken sections, clearing blockages, and restoring proper flow in both indoor and outdoor drain lines. Homeowners often seek drain pipe repairs to prevent water damage, eliminate foul odors, and ensure the plumbing system functions efficiently, especially after experiencing backups, slow drains, or visible pipe deterioration.
Before requesting drain pipe repair,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the damage, the cause of the problem, and the best solution for their specific situation. It’s helpful to know whether repairs involve simple patching or require pipe replacement, as well as the materials used and the potential impact on landscaping or property features. Clear communication about the scope of work and any necessary preparations can help ensure the repair process proceeds smoothly and effectively.

Common Drain Pipe Repair Jobs
Drain pipe repairs involve fixing leaks, cracks, or blockages to restore proper drainage.
Pipe replacements are necessary when existing pipes are severely damaged or corroded.
Clog removal services help prevent backups and flooding caused by debris or buildup.
Leak detection services identify hidden pipe leaks that can cause water damage over time.
Section repairs focus on fixing specific damaged areas without replacing entire drain lines.
Preventive maintenance helps extend the lifespan of drainage systems and avoid costly repairs.
Drain Pipe Repair Questions
What signs indicate drain pipe damage? Signs include slow draining sinks, gurgling sounds, unpleasant odors, or water backups in fixtures.
Can drain pipes be repaired without full replacement? Yes, minor damages like cracks or blockages can often be fixed with targeted repairs or lining methods.
What causes drain pipes to deteriorate? Common causes include age, tree root intrusion, corrosion, and improper installation or maintenance.
Is it necessary to inspect drain pipes regularly? Routine inspections can help identify issues early and prevent costly repairs or property damage.
